Transaction 54edfcd83e21ee2c56dff4aafd32109f5f93b740de5402153cc620a84aee7048

1 Input
2 Outputs
  • 54edfcd83e21ee2c56dff4aafd32109f5f93b740de5402153cc620a84aee7048:0
  • value  1004000
    address  1iL8XYa3F5KGPGrLRnDifhKTevZN9dr3N
  • 54edfcd83e21ee2c56dff4aafd32109f5f93b740de5402153cc620a84aee7048:1
  • value  17007490
    address  1Nj5PuFRSNQiWyQVYjSVVSryKcA145uE9S